Claims this source supports
- Survey (2026, n=402 women ages 30-80+ who are perimenopausal, menopausal, or postmenopausal): only 14% recognize dry eye as a menopause-related symptom, compared to 79% who recognize hot flashes.
- 78% of women were surprised to learn that dry eye is a symptom of perimenopause or menopause.
- Survey framing: hormonal changes affect tear production, tear quality and tear evaporation; dry eye impacts reading, screen use, driving and productivity, with 33% reporting effects on stress/anxiety, 29% on productivity, 28% on mood and 22% on self-confidence.
